| # FinePDFs-Edu — English, Pre-tokenized & Length-Bucketed |
|
|
| A **high-quality, pre-tokenized, length-bucketed** derivative of |
| [`HuggingFaceFW/finepdfs-edu`](https://huggingface.co/datasets/HuggingFaceFW/finepdfs-edu), |
| prepared as a drop-in corpus for **distributed continuous / continual pretraining** (CPT). |
|
|
| The source documents are filtered to confident English, tokenized once with the |
| [`jet-ai/Jet-Nemotron-2B`](https://huggingface.co/jet-ai/Jet-Nemotron-2B) tokenizer, and written to |
| flat `uint32` token shards that are **partitioned by sequence length** so that training jobs can pull |
| short or long sequences on demand (e.g. length-based batching, curriculum, or long-context stages) |
| without re-tokenizing or re-scanning the corpus. |

| ## How the data was produced |
|
|
| The corpus was produced by the following reproducible pipeline: |
|
|
| 1. **Load** `HuggingFaceFW/finepdfs-edu`, config **`eng_Latn`**, split `train` (23,023,372 documents). |
| 2. **Filter to confident English** (all conditions required): |
| - `language == "eng_Latn"` |
| - `page_average_lid == "eng_Latn"` |
| - `page_average_lid_score >= 0.90` *(LID confidence threshold)* |
| - `token_count >= 1` |
| 3. **Tokenize** each surviving document with `AutoTokenizer.from_pretrained("jet-ai/Jet-Nemotron-2B", trust_remote_code=True)` |
| using `add_special_tokens=False`, then **append a single EOS token** (`151643`, `<|endoftext|>`). |
| No BOS token is added; no padding is stored. |
| 4. **Bucket** each document by its final token count (text tokens + EOS) into length buckets. |
| 5. **Shard & write** as raw little-endian `uint32` bytes into 32 partitions, rolling to a new file at |
| ~1.5 GB. Documents within each shard are concatenated and separated only by their trailing EOS. |

| ## Statistics |
|
|
| Retained **18,198,668** documents / **≈ 90.81B** tokens from **23,023,372** raw `eng_Latn` documents. |
|
|
| | Bucket | Sequence length (tokens, inclusive) | Documents | |
| |---|---|---:| |
| | `1024` | 1 – 1,024 | 7,811,084 | |
| | `2048` | 1,025 – 2,048 | 3,557,339 | |
| | `4096` | 2,049 – 4,096 | 2,536,902 | |
| | `8192` | 4,097 – 8,192 | 2,150,060 | |
| | `16384` | 8,193 – 16,384 | 1,192,685 | |
| | `32768` | 16,385 – 32,768 | 560,185 | |
| | `65536` | 32,769 – 65,536 | 235,401 | |
| | `131072` | 65,537 – 131,072 | 98,452 | |
| | `262144` | 131,073 – 262,144 | 39,142 | |
| | `beyond` | > 262,144 | 17,418 | |
| | **Total** | | **18,198,668** | |
|
|
| A bucket named `N` holds documents whose token length is **≤ N** and **> the previous bound**. |

| ### File format |
|
|
| - **dtype:** little-endian `uint32` (4 bytes/token) — required because the vocabulary (151,936) exceeds `uint16`. |
| - **structure:** documents concatenated back-to-back; each document ends with **exactly one EOS token |
| (`151643`)**. No BOS, no padding, no per-document header. |
| - To recover document boundaries, split on the EOS id. |

| ODC-By is a permissive **attribution** license: it permits copying, modification, creation of derivative |
| databases, and redistribution. There is **no share-alike** obligation. To comply you must: |
| |
| 1. **Attribute** the source — credit **FinePDFs-Edu / Hugging Face** and preserve their |
| [citation](#citation). |
| 2. **Preserve notices** — keep the ODC-By license and this attribution intact in any further |
| redistribution, and link or include the license text. |
| 3. **Honor removals** — propagate opt-out / PII-removal requests downstream (see below). |
| |
| Because there is no share-alike clause, a downstream user *may* relicense their own further derivative; |
| keeping `odc-by` is the simplest compliant choice and is what this repository does. |
